Abstract
The utility model discloses a grinding device on a tapered roller ball base surface grinding machine. The grinding device comprises tapered rollers, an isolation disk and an abrasion wheel. A cylinder bracket is fixed on a base; a thin cylinder with a guide rod is fixed on the cylinder bracket; an oil stone rack is arranged on the guide rod of the thin cylinder; a proximity switch is mounted on the tubular cylinder with the guide rod; an oil stone is mounted on the oil stone rack; a positioning pin is arranged between the cylinder bracket and the base. According to the technical scheme, when the tapered rollers are ground by the grinding machine, the coarse abrasion wheel can be utilized to grind the ball base surfaces of the tapered rollers, and then the ball base surfaces of the tapered rollers are ground by the oil stone with a super-finishing structure, so that the precision and the surface roughness of the ball base surfaces of the tapered rollers are improved. Thus, the grinding and the abrasive milling of the ball base surfaces of the tapered rollers are finished by one step.
Description
Technical field:
The utility model relates to the lapping device on a kind of grinding machine for spherical fiducial surface of conical roller, is specially adapted to the processing of spherical base surface of tapered roller.
Background technology:
Taper roller is the important component part of taper roll bearing, the processing of spherical base surface of tapered roller is normally undertaken by grinding machine for spherical fiducial surface of conical roller, in the course of the work, when selecting than fine grinding wheel, spherical base surface of tapered roller produces burn easily, directly causes machining accuracy to descend, and inefficiency, with adding man-hour than coarse plain emery wheel, the spherical base surface of tapered roller roughness does not often reach required precision.
Summary of the invention:
Task of the present utility model is to propose a kind of burn that can not produce spherical base surface of tapered roller in the process of grinding, can reach required precision again, and is improved the lapping device on a kind of grinding machine for spherical fiducial surface of conical roller of operating efficiency.
Task of the present utility model is finished like this, lapping device on a kind of grinding machine for spherical fiducial surface of conical roller, it comprises taper roller, separator and emery wheel, it is characterized in that: air cylinder support is fixed on the base, guide rod thin type cylinder is fixed on the air cylinder support, and the guide rod on the described guide rod thin type cylinder is provided with the oilstone frame, and approach switch is contained on the tubular cylinder of guide rod, on the oilstone frame oilstone is housed, alignment pin is set in the middle of air cylinder support and the base.Base is fixed on the lathe bed, and described guide rod thin type cylinder is positioned at the below of emery wheel and installs.
The utlity model has following effect: owing to taked technique scheme, when lathe grinding taper roller, can adopt thicker emery wheel to come the ball basal plane of grinding taper roller, then the oilstone by the superfinishing structure grinds spherical base surface of tapered roller, precision and the surface roughness of spherical base surface of tapered roller have been improved, the lathe course of work is continuity, has realized the grinding of roller ball basal plane and ground once finishing.Be difficult for selecting and the spherical base surface of tapered roller unmanageable problem of burning thereby solved the emery wheel thickness, have simple in structure, machining accuracy is high, the working (machining) efficiency advantages of higher.
Description of drawings:
Fig. 1 is structural representation of the present utility model.
Drawing explanation: 1, taper roller, 2, separator, 3, emery wheel, 4, the oilstone frame, 5, oilstone, 6, guide rod thin type cylinder, 7, approach switch, 8, air cylinder support, 9, alignment pin, 10, base.
The specific embodiment:
Describe embodiment in detail in conjunction with above accompanying drawing, this structure connection is finished the grinding of spherical base surface of tapered roller with pneumatic control, pneumatic control is to pass through triple valve, the air composition element, the four-way hand-operated valve, guide rod thin type cylinder forms, this structure is positioned at the below of emery wheel 3 and installs, base 10 is fixed on the lathe bed, air cylinder support 8 is fixed on the base, guide rod thin type cylinder is fixed on the air cylinder support 8, guide rod on the described guide rod thin type cylinder is provided with oilstone frame 4, approach switch 7 is contained on the tubular cylinder of guide rod, oilstone 5 is housed on the oilstone frame, alignment pin 9 is set in the middle of air cylinder support and the base, the angle of oilstone can be adjusted by the screw on the air cylinder support, oilstone can be controlled by the four-way hand-operated valve, be placed with dividing plate dish 2 in the taper roller, emery wheel is assemblied on the grinding carriage, during the grinding taper roller, processed taper roller 1 is put on the separator 2, rotation by separator, the drive taper roller enters emery wheel 3 and carries out grinding, when taper roller enters oilstone first, rotating four-way hand-operated valve conducting guide rod thin type cylinder pressurizes, thereby beginning is ground taper roller by oilstone, after grinding beginning, do not need to carry out Artificial Control, give guide rod thin type cylinder pressure by compressed air always, make oilstone keep pressure to spherical base surface of tapered roller, thereby grind; In the time of making oilstone be about to use extreme position by adjusting the approach switch 7 that is equipped with on the guide rod thin type cylinder, warning can be pointed out and produce to lathe, reminds operating personnel to change oilstone; When oilstone arrived the limit of wear, the screw on the detachable oilstone frame was changed oilstone.
